Home Notes and News.
General Farre, the Prtnoh Minister of War, has gone to Le Mam.
The King of, Spain has conferred the Order of the Golden Fleece on the Sultan.
, The Her. Canon Cook, of Exeter, has resigned the preachership of Lincoln's* inn.
The Austrian Minister of War asks for a rote of 8,500,000 florins for fortifications in the Tjrol and Galicia.
The Prince of Wales was present at the cricket match between the Windsor Garrison and I Zingari.
Mr Alderman Sidney, the representative for Billingsgate ward, has sent in"" his resignation to the Lord Mayor. *-
Mr Beresford-Hope presided on June 12th at the seventy-first anniversary dinner of the Artists' Benevolent Fund,. '
The Her. A. H. Mackonochie contentplates taking a holiday extending orer some months in Canada and the united States.
